This is a great comedy CD. Mike Rayburn is a musician/comedian who knows his stuff, both playing and making people laugh. The thing that mazed me most about this CD, and made me happy beyond belief, was the lack of swearing. I had started to think that the only way comedians thought they could be funny anymore was with an f-this and an f-that every other word. Mike skips all that to give you some really funny, raw talent, without the turn off of naughty words. the best things about Mike's comedic style is his blend of the comedy with music. He does these great skits where he does the music of one artist as it would sound sung by another artist. Like (included on this CD) Bob Marley sings Garth brooks, Dan Fogelberg sings AC/DC and even Led Zeppelin sings Dr. Seuss (which is one of my favorites).
With his musical talent. Mike has made this live performance at Carnegie Hall one to remember, even if all you get is to listen to it on this CD. Other funny parts are his Boy Bands skit, where he pretty much just makes fun of them... but it's great. And I also love The Devil, which is Mike's rendition of The Devil Went Down To Georgia.
I highly recommend picking up this CD. It will have you laughing in no time, and you can even share it with the kids!
